The Houthis are reported to be advancing an Iranian-backed strategy that contributed to Saudi Arabia closing the Petroline, an alternative pipeline to the Strait of Hormuz. The development adds a concrete disruption to regional oil transport.

Loss of an alternative export route could increase pressure on Gulf energy shipments and amplify global oil-supply risks if disruption around Hormuz persists.
